SEOPS Awarded Launch Services Task Order for Upcoming NASA VADR Mission

Company brings wealth of experience to R5-S9 mission, providing end-to-end mission services, from capacity procurement and testing to deployment hardware.

Houston, TX – December 9, 2024SEOPS, a leading provider of responsive space mission services, has been selected to provide launch and integration services for a small satellite mission under a recent task order awarded by NASA under the Venture-Class Acquisition of Dedicated and Rideshare (VADR) launch services contract. Under the terms of the award, the Houston-based company will support the Streamlined CubeSat Launch Services (SCLS) R5-S9 Mission by procuring a launch for the 6U CubeSat and providing payload processing and integration services, testing, fit checks, and all necessary hardware including its Equalizer dispenser. The launch is currently slated for 2025.

“Working with NASA on VADR missions is very rewarding for our team, and we’re extremely proud to play a role in delivering positive science outcomes from the R5-S9 mission,” said Chad Brinkley, CEO of SEOPS. “We have a long history of executing missions for the U.S. government and are grateful they continue to rely on our mission expertise.”

One of 13 companies selected in 2022 to provide VADR launch services, SEOPS is part of a vetted group of established and emerging vehicle and service providers. Bringing nearly a decade of experience in payload integration, mission management, and deployment solutions, SEOPS also provides in-house designed and engineered flight hardware and an orbital transfer vehicle. SEOPS most recently announced it signed a contract with SpaceX for a direct-to-GTO Falcon 9 rideshare mission in late 2028. The team collectively brings expertise from more than 400 satellite deployments, including for the U.S. Space Force, NASA, and NRO. Additionally, the company has managed 16 rideshare launches, including many SpaceX Transporter and International Space Station cargo rendezvous missions.
